| Object Number | NA5662 |
| Current Location | Collections Storage |
| Culture | Tohono O'odham |
| Provenience | Arizona (uncertain) |
| Culture Area | Southwest Culture Area |
| Section | American |
| Materials | Clay | Pigment |
| Technique | Coiled |
| Description | Pot / Water Bottle. Spherical jar with short, slightly flaring narrow neck. Light color slip background. Rim with solid dark brown stripe. Neck and shoulder with dark brown dots. Four horizontal lines around lower shoulder. Six petal/leaf shaped designs on body. |
| Height | 20.5 cm |
| Outside Diameter | 17.78 cm |
| Credit Line | Gift of Mrs. Westray Ladd, 1917 |
